Transaction 65e692769887e7394ec682ba8b53b6cd4ec33f968711f48cd02ae22c1c3d2632
1 Input
1 Output
-
65e692769887e7394ec682ba8b53b6cd4ec33f968711f48cd02ae22c1c3d2632:0
- value
- 47406126
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cac8284d3730efaf9ae8a622940392bd8a605e05 OP_EQUAL
- address
- 3LBECUXZsLdipfA8SZwFuvtJAwx9gHWrVA